WHEN last year 19 elected members of the Imperial Legislative Council submitted a memorandum on post-war reforms in India, it was understood that the matter was urgent as the Government of India was about to prepare a despatch on the subject to the Secretary of State. It is believed that by this time the said despatch has been sent, and we notice that an appeal has been made to the Government of India to publish it so that the people in this country may know to what extent the Government of India has supported the people's desires. The present Viceroy has more than once declared that he would, as far as possible, follow the welcome policy of his predecessor, Lord Hardinge, in sympathising with and helping people's aspiration.
